This powerful and thought-provoking print from Mary Evans Picture Library titled "Evolution / Art Apes Life" captures a poignant moment in history. In the image, an extremely talented aspiring monkey artist is seen sketching a less fortunate fellow monkey who is chained up. The contrast between the two monkeys - one free to create art, while the other is restricted by chains - speaks volumes about the complexities of evolution and society. The historical significance of this scene cannot be understated. It serves as a reminder of how far we have come as a species in terms of artistic expression and freedom, but also highlights the inequalities that still exist in our world today. The tunic-wearing artist monkey symbolizes progress and potential, while his chained counterpart represents oppression and limitation. Through this unique depiction of monkeys engaging in artistry, the viewer is prompted to reflect on themes of creativity, ambition, privilege, and injustice. The act of sketching becomes not just a means of expression for these animals, but also a metaphor for the broader human experience. Overall, "Evolution / Art Apes Life" challenges us to consider our own roles in shaping society and promoting equality for all beings. It is a testament to the power of art to provoke conversation and inspire change.
